titleOfInvention A kind of extraction-type flue-gas temperature distributed measurement device and include its denitrification apparatus
abstract The utility model discloses a kind of extraction-type flue-gas temperature distributed measurement device and its denitrification apparatus is included, measuring device includes mixing sampling pipe, sampling branch pipe, temperature-measuring element and temperature sampler;Sampling branch pipe one end is connected with mixing sampling pipe, and for negative pressure end occurs for the other end;One end that temperature-measuring element is located on sampling branch pipe and is connected positioned at sampling branch pipe with mixing sampling pipe, temperature-measuring element are connected with temperature sampler.The application has the significant advantages such as smoke temperature measurement accuracy is high, reliability is high, cost of investment is low.
